Eurostars Call 12 opens on 17 December 2026 for international SME collaborations

Innovative SMEs working together with international partners on the development of new products, processes or services can soon begin preparing for Eurostars Call 12. The new call opens on 17 December 2026 and closes on 4 March 2027. Eurostars Call 11 is also currently open for applications and will remain open until 10 September 2026.

Which projects are eligible for Eurostars Call 12?

The Eurostars programme supports market-oriented R&D projects carried out by international consortia. The programme is specifically aimed at innovative SMEs that play a leading role in the development of new technologies and innovations.

Participating countries each make their own budget available. The following countries have not allocated a budget: Cyprus, Italy and Israel. SMEs from these countries may therefore participate in a consortium, but only using their own funding.

Who can apply for Eurostars funding?

To be eligible for Eurostars, a consortium must meet several international requirements, including:

  • The consortium is led by an SME from a Eurostars country;
  • The consortium consists of at least two independent organisations from at least two different Eurostars countries;
  • At least 50% of the project budget is covered by SMEs, with no more than 70% of the total project budget covered by a single partner.

How does the Eurostars application process work?

The application procedure consists of two steps. First, the consortium submits a joint project application to the Eureka Secretariat. Only projects that receive a positive international evaluation are invited to subsequently submit a national funding application to the Netherlands Enterprise Agency (RVO).
